Boca Tampa – Review
If you’re in the Hyde Park area of South Tampa, then you should try Boca. It is a kitchen, bar, and market offering fresh and local food by using ingredients from nearby farmers. Pinky’s Diner Review – Tampa
Pinky’s Diner is in the Palma Ceia neighborhood, which is south of downtown Tampa. Pinky’s interior is small and gets very cramped during the rush. China Yuan Chinese Restaurant Review – Tampa
If you want authentic Chinese food, China Yuan is the place to get it. Serving a variety of Cantonese style foods, as well as other regional dishes, China Yuan is not like the Chinese places you see next to Target or Publix serving chow mein.
